First, they've declared that the cervical cancer jab should be rolled out to girls.  Yay!  A jab against cancer!  Bloody marvellous - and so good to see that they haven't got bogged down in the rubbish that snarls the Americans, where HPV's status as a sexually-transmitted disease means that the fundies are upset about injecting young kids.  Um, hello? The idea is you inoculate them before they're active.  In the real world, 12-13 is ideal.  This is a jab for a nasty cancer.  Moral balance, you doofs.

A second bunch of boffins have said that a badger cull would be useless in preventing TB in cattle.  It would only work if one could totally extinctify the wheezy brocks, which I'm glad to say is as technically impossible as it is morally repugnant.  Various farmers who haven't read the science are grumbling about how the Government really ought to commit speciecide to protect their profits - I'm embarassed to say, most of them seem to be from round here.
